## Changelog — Ticktrace 1.9

### Renamed: DRIFT_API_TOKEN
During the cron drift investigation we found plugins confusing this variable with the metrics token, so it has been renamed to indicate it authorizes drift-report uploads specifically. Plugin authors must read the new name from 1.9 onward; the old name is ignored without warning. Sample env files in the SDK are updated. In your deployment env file, the drift-report upload secret is set on the next line.

env line for fawef-taguf: VAULT_KEY13=a9695905a9a90

**Facilities ticket — Hollybeck Court**

Heads up: from Monday the canteen opens to folks from Tarnwick Analytics next door as part of the shared-services trial. Expect a busier lunch rush and keep the connecting corridor door propped only during service hours. After 14:30 it locks again, so staff should use the side entry code.

turnstile pass: bdg-NG-3

Step 4: Enable monthly partitioning on the ledger tables. Once the Varnholt schema migration completes, the Quillbase service switches writes to partitioned tables keyed by event month. Old rows remain in the legacy table until the backfill job finishes; do not drop anything before sign-off from the data team. Verify that partition creation is scheduled ahead of month boundaries, otherwise inserts will fail at rollover. Apply the following configuration values to the Quillbase service before restarting it.

service settings:
PRAWYN_PIN=9848
PRAWYN_METRICS_HOST=metrics.prawyn.lumicworks.corp
PRAWYN_LOG_LEVEL=warn
PRAWYN_TENANT=pelius

// GPU memory profiling — Vramlens plugin interface.
// This constant sets the default sampling interval (in milliseconds) for
// allocation snapshots taken by the Vramlens profiler. Plugin authors should
// treat it as a floor: intervals below this value cause the snapshot ring
// buffer to wrap before the collector drains it, producing gaps in the
// timeline. If you override it, document the change in your plugin manifest.
// Profiles are only comparable across runs compiled against the same core,
// identified by the build token below.

session token of bawep-yadup = htk21_528abd376e3c5a4ec24a1